Core Insights - The article emphasizes the importance of emotional marketing during Mother's Day, urging brands to move away from traditional praise and instead focus on genuine insights and emotional resonance to create differentiated communication strategies [1] Marketing Strategies: Addressing Emotional Gaps - Pain Point Focus: The ultimate goal of Mother's Day marketing is to ensure mothers feel seen and understood, rather than just evoking tears. Research indicates that 76% of mothers are more likely to purchase from brands that acknowledge parenting pressures [3] - Scene Resonance: As societal views evolve, family roles are no longer solely tied to female value. Brands should shift their narratives from celebrating sacrifice to respecting choices, with data showing that ads featuring family scenes have a 47% higher click-through rate [5] - Value Reconstruction: In an era where self-care awareness among women is rising, Mother's Day marketing should encourage mothers to pursue self-consumption, aligning with the trend of "her economy" [8] Communication Phases: Navigating User Decision-Making - Phase One: Emotional Preheating - Brands can engage potential customers through emotional storytelling campaigns, enhancing brand affinity and preparing for subsequent marketing efforts [10] - Phase Two: Traffic Explosion - Following emotional preheating, brands should focus on promotional conversion, utilizing targeted advertising and real-time consumer interaction to drive sales [11] - Phase Three: Long-Tail Continuation - Post-campaign, brands need to maintain communication to solidify brand image and expand influence, leveraging media and social platforms for ongoing engagement [14]
